tr007 James Bond Ocean Club Suite, Nassau, Bahamas
The Ocean Club, featured prominently in Casino Royale, actually exists. The very suite in which Daniel Craig is sitting while using the laptop computer is available for rent on the One&Only Ocean Club website.

tr018 Villa Le Torre, Southern Tuscany, Italy
Villa Le Torre, located near Talamone (6km), in Southern Tuscany, Italy, is featured in the James Bond film Quantum of Solace. Bond, after leaving the Tosca Opera in Bregenz, visits Mathis (and his girlfriend) in this beautiful villa.

tr008 Villa del Balbianello, Lake Como, Italy
Villa del Balbianello is located next to Lake Como, Italy. In the spring of 2006, the movie Casino Royale was filmed in front of the villa (the outdoor scenes of Bond recovering).

tr006 Villa La Gaeta, Lake Como, Italy
Villa La Gaeta is located next to Lake Como, Italy, surrounded by a beautiful park with paths, benches and a lit fountain. In the spring of 2006, the movie Casino Royale was filmed in front of this villa (the last scene of the movie).

tr010 Hotel Pupp (Hotel Splendide), Karlovy Vary, Czech Republic
Grand Hotel Pupp, a 228-room luxury hotel located in Karlovy Vary (Carlsbad), Czech Republic, doubles for Hotel Splendide in Montenegro in the 2006 movie Casino Royale.

tr009 Verzasca Dam, Locarno, Switzerland
In the opening sequence of the 1995 movie Goldeneye, James Bond jumps off the Verzasca Dam in Switzerland. The Dam is 220 meter (720 feet) high hydroelectric dam, and is located close to the city Locarno.

tr012 Piz Gloria, Schilthorn, Switzerland
Many scenes were filmed at Piz Gloria for the 1969 James Bond 007 film On Her Majesty's Secret Service. Piz Gloria is located on top of Schilthorn, a 2,970 metre high summit in the Bernese Oberland, Switzerland, above Mürren.

tr016 Hotel Atlantic Kempinski, Hamburg, Germany
The Atlantic Hotel was featured in the 1997 Bond movie, Tomorrow Never Dies. A few scenes were shot here, but one of the most memorable is the stunt scene in which Pierce Brosnan - or rather his stunt double - climbs from the Atlantic Suite to the globe on the roof of the hotel after Bond killed Dr. Kaufman. Present are, besides Pierce Brosnan, the German actor Götz Otto, the director Roger Spottiswalde and a crew of 150.

tr001 Goldeneye, Jamaica
Ian Fleming's beloved Jamaican home where he wrote 14 of his famous 007 novels. What Fleming loved most about Goldeneye was the out of doors, nature, the sounds and colors, the peace and drama of living by the sea. He delighted in "the blazing sunshine, natural beauty and the most healthy life I could live."

tr002 Stoke Poges, UK
Stoke Park Club with its 27 hole golf course, Stoke Poges, and award winning spa, SPA SPC, is one of the most special places in the world, in one of the most convenient locations in Britain. Scenes from Goldfinger (1964) and Tomorrow Never Dies (1997) were filmed in and around the Clubhouse and on the championship golf course, Stoke Poges.

tr003 British Colonial Hilton Nassau, Bahamas
Both Thunderball and Never Say Never Again were shot at the swank, canary yellow, 77-year-old business hotel that is conveniently nestled in downtown Nassau.

tr014 Fort Antoine Theatre, Monaco
In the 1995 James Bond movie GoldenEye, Pierce Brosnan as Bond watches from the Fort Antoine theatre how Xenia Onatop and the admiral board a speedboat in Monte Carlo's port.

tr004 Casino Barrière de Deauville, France
In the novel Casino Royale, Bond plays Baccarat against villain Le Chiffre in the fictitious Casino of Royale-les-Eaux. Fleming based this casino on this real casino in Deauville.
